def __init__(self, mainWindow, repo, user, guiUpdater): self._repo = repo self._user = user self._mainWindow = mainWindow self.__actionHandlers = ActionHandlerStorage(guiUpdater) self.__favoriteReposStorage = FavoriteReposStorage() self._tools = [] for tool in self.__getAvailableTools(): self.__initTool(tool)
def createGui(self, guiParent): self._gui = FileBrowserGui(guiParent, self) self._actionHandlers = ActionHandlerStorage(self._guiUpdater) logger.debug("File Browser GUI created.") return self._gui